SES S.A. has agreed to acquire Intelsat Holdings S.à r.l. in a strategic acquisition within the communications sector. The transaction was announced on 11 April 2025 and subsequently completed on 29 May 2025. The target company is based in Luxembourg, although the confidence regarding this specific location is noted as low. No financial consideration or deal value was disclosed in the available records, and the specific form of payment remains unreported.
This acquisition brings the satellite communications assets of Intelsat under the ownership of SES, a leading global satellite operator. The deal represents a significant consolidation of capabilities within the international communications industry. Regulatory bodies have reviewed the transaction and granted the necessary clearances for completion. The transaction is subject to regulatory approval.
